Strategic Leadership: Mike Alfred's Track Record and Vision

Mike Alfred is no stranger to building and scaling high-impact ventures in the fintech and digital asset spaces. As co-founder of BrightScope (acquired by Strategic Insight) and Digital Assets Data (acquired by NYDIG), he has demonstrated a knack for identifying gaps in financial markets and filling them with data-driven solutions. His current role as Founder and Managing Partner of Alpine Fox LP—a fund focused on

and AI-related equities—further cements his credibility in two of the most transformative asset classes today Bakkt Appoints Mike Alfred to Board to Accelerate Growth Strategy[2].

Alfred's appointment is not merely symbolic. His expertise in digital asset trading, stablecoin payments, and AI-powered finance aligns directly with Bakkt's long-term strategy to “redefine financial infrastructure” Bakkt Strengthens Growth Strategy with Board Addition: What …[3]. Notably, his board membership at IREN, a developer of data centers for Bitcoin and AI operations, adds a layer of institutional credibility to Bakkt's ambitions in these fields. CEO Akshay Naheta emphasized that Alfred's experience and network are critical to advancing Bakkt's vision, particularly in areas like Bitcoin adoption and AI-driven financial services Benchmark Begins Coverage on Bakkt (NYSE:BKKT)[4].

Market Confidence: A Confluence of Leadership and Performance

The market's enthusiastic response to Alfred's appointment reflects a growing belief in Bakkt's strategic direction. According to a report by Yahoo Finance, shares of

surged over 40% in premarket trading, fueled by investor optimism about the company's governance and growth prospects Bakkt Holdings (BKKT) Surges After New Board Appointment[5]. This momentum is further supported by Bakkt's Q1 2025 financial results, which included a 25.8% year-over-year revenue increase and a net income of $16.2 million—driven by stronger crypto market activity and cost reductions Bakkt Reports First Quarter 2025 Results[6].

Analysts have also thrown their weight behind the stock. Benchmark Company initiated a “buy” rating with a $13 target price, citing Bakkt's “innovative leadership and restructuring efforts” as key drivers of long-term value .
